San Marcos junior Stella Ashamalla earned medalist honors with a 46 at Sandpiper Thursday to lead the Royals to a 246 to 304 victory of Royal.
“She had a really strong finish to the round, playing the last six holes at 4 over par,” San Marcos coach Sarah Ashton said. “Her positive mental approach really helped her steady play.”
Evelina Erickson was right behind with 47 and Fia Torrey shot a 49 for San Marcos.
“I was really pleased with the consistency all-around today, and I like where we are headed,” Ashton said.

Lompoc 270, Santa Barbara 289
Halee Sager shot a 46 at La Purisima Thursday to learn Lompoc to a win over Santa Barbara.
“Today was probably the most challenging course the girls will play all year,” Santa Barbara coach Ryan Throop said. “It was windy, greens were quick and the course was in very good condition. Lompoc managed their home course better than we did.”
For the Dons, “Junior Lauren Fitzgerald had an excellent round with a 48 given the conditions,” Throop said. “She parred hole 9 and was consistently long off the tee.”
Santa Barbara is now 2-3 overall and 2-1 in Channel League play.
